Greenways

A Greenways network is developing across the county. 
Horse riding on the High Peak Trail

The network includes traffic-free pathways that connect Derbyshire’s towns and villages to both dramatic and gentle countryside and are suitable for walking, cycling and horse riding. 

All routes are surfaced and many are built on flat routes for easy access. They are suitable for all the family, prams and mobility scooters. 

Greenways provide sustainable and healthy travel routes to schools, work places, shops and local amenities, whilst offering tranquil green routes out of town to your local countryside. 

Routes interconnect to form wider circuits, perfect for a short holiday break.
